U.S. patent number D791,240 [Application Number D/563,578] was granted by the patent office on 2017-07-04 for illuminated sign. This patent grant is currently assigned to BOT Home Automation, Inc.. The grantee listed for this patent is BOT HOME AUTOMATION, INC.. Invention is credited to Elliott Lemberger, James Siminoff.

Description



FIG. 1 is a front prospective view of the illuminated sign according to the present design;

FIG. 2 is a front elevational view of the illuminated sign of FIG. 1;

FIG. 3 is a rear elevational view of the illuminated sign of FIG. 1;

FIG. 4 is a right-side elevational view of the illuminated sign of FIG. 1, the left-side elevational view being a mirror image thereof;

FIG. 5 is a top plan view of the illuminated sign of FIG. 1;

FIG. 6 is a bottom plan view of the illuminated sign of FIG. 1; and,

FIG. 7 is a front perspective view of the illuminated sign of FIG. 1, showing the illuminated sign in a manner of use.

The broken line showing of elements on the illuminated sign illustrate portions of the article and form no part of the claimed design.
